Q: Is 202,077,830 a Prime Number?
A: No, 202,077,830 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 202077830 can be evenly divided by 1 2 5 10 2,903 5,806 6,961 13,922 14,515 29,030 34,805 69,610 20,207,783 40,415,566 101,038,915 and 202,077,830, with no remainder.
Since 202,077,830 cannot be divided by just 1 and 202,077,830, it is not a prime number.
